ELKHART — Mildred D. Brenner, 96, of Elkhart, formerly of Millersburg, Mich., passed away Wednesday, March 7, 2012, at Valley View Health Care Center in Elkhart.

She was born March 28, 1915, in Millersburg, Mich., to Matthias and Myrtle (Vilburn) Robbins, both deceased. She married Charles E. Brenner on May 19, 1936, in Onaway, Mich. He passed away May 18, 1961.

Surviving are daughter Bev (Larry) Christensen of Elkhart; granddaughter Suzette (John) Hudak of Edwardsburg, Mich.; grandson Jeff (Tracy) Clark; stepgranddaughter Stacy Clementz of Elkhart; six great-grandchildren; one stepgreat-grandson; three great-great-granddaughters; one stepgreat-great-grandson; and sisters-in-law Laurie Robbins of Onaway and Beulah Brenner.

She was preceded in death by her parents and one brother, George Robbins.

A graveside service will take place at a later date with burial in Riverside Cemetery, Millersburg. Memorials may be made to the Millersburg Historical Society. Arrangements have been entrusted with Waterman Westbrook Clouse Funeral Home, Elkhart.

Published: Elkhart Truth, Sat., Mar. 10, 2012
